    Gerry Conway has decided to reclaim The Punisher's logo for the cause of equal justice with a Black Lives Matter fundraising campaign called Skulls for Justice.

    "For too long, symbols associated with a character I co-created have been co-opted by forces of oppression and to intimidate black Americans," said Conway. "This character and symbol was never intended as a symbol of oppression. This is a symbol of a systematic failure of equal justice. It’s time to claim this symbol for the cause of equal justice and Black Lives Matter."
